Many countries, such as Spain, Portugal, the Netherlands, and the United Kingdom, have funded their researchers' expeditions. The newly discovered lands belonged to the countries that discovered them. The rulers financed these expeditions because they knew that all the money invested would be returned to them many times. The exploitation of natural and mineral resources, territories, and slave labor are some of the elements from which the rulers benefited materially.
